From 7694d8374d14c3d17b153261befe3681c3e280bf Mon Sep 17 00:00:00 2001 From: marco Date: Sat, 27 May 2006 19:51:54 +0000 Subject: [PATCH] * 6.4 fixes git-svn-id: trunk@3704 - --- packages/base/gdbint/gdbint.pp |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/packages/base/gdbint/gdbint.pp b/packages/base/gdbint/gdbint.pp index fa043e677c..e4652b20e8 100644 --- a/packages/base/gdbint/gdbint.pp +++ b/packages/base/gdbint/gdbint.pp @@ -30,6 +30,11 @@ interface {$define GDB_V6} {$endif def GDB_V603} +{$ifdef GDB_V604} + {$define GDB_V6} +{$endif def GDB_V604} + + {$ifdef GDB_V6} {$define GDB_HAS_SYSROOT} {$define GDB_SYMTAB_HAS_MACROS} @@ -2359,8 +2364,10 @@ end; var version : array[0..0] of char;cvar;external; +{$ifndef GDB_V604} +// doesn't seem to exist anymore. Seems to work fine without procedure error_init;cdecl;external; - +{$endif} function GDBVersion : string; begin @@ -2414,7 +2421,9 @@ begin gdb_stdtarg:=gdb_stderr; set_ui_file_write(gdb_stdout,@gdbint_ui_file_write); set_ui_file_write(gdb_stderr,@gdbint_ui_file_write); +{$ifndef GDB_V604} error_init; +{$endif} {$ifdef GDB_V6} // gdb_stdtargin := gdb_stdin; gdb_stdtargerr := gdb_stderr;